The real cost of a missed call
For a roofing company after a hailstorm, one missed call could be a $15,000 insurance job. For a dental office on a Monday morning, it's a new patient who scheduled elsewhere. For a plumber at 2 AM, it's an emergency repair that went to the competitor who picked up. The math is simple: if you miss 5 calls a week at an average job value of $500, that's $2,000/week in lost revenue.
How 100% answer rate works
The AI receptionist picks up on the first ring. There's no queue, no hold music, no 'please leave a message.' Whether it's the first call of the day or the fiftieth during a storm surge, the caller gets an immediate, professional answer. Simultaneous calls are handled in parallel — unlimited concurrency means no busy signals.
What happens to the leads
Every call produces structured data: caller name, phone number, reason for call, urgency level, and action taken. Leads flow into your dashboard and sync to your CRM. Booking requests appear on your calendar. Emergency pages go to your on-call tech immediately. You get a transcript and summary for every call.
